Base access is the step to plan before arrival: visitors without a DoD ID must stop at the Lewis Main Visitor Control Center, open 5 a.m. to 10 p.m. daily, while Liberty Gate at I-5 Exit 120 processes visitors from 10 p.m. to 5 a.m. An adult authorized DoD sponsor must also be available by phone for the temporary-pass process; the full schedule is on the official JBLM visitor and gate information page. Your bus keeps the personnel together while everyone clears the same access point instead of arriving in a scattered line of vehicles.

At SEA, everyone gathers with every bag before you call the venue directly at (206) 787-5906 for the bus to be dispatched; the charter-bus pickup point is the North East Charter Bus Lot on the north end of the parking structure, reached from Baggage Claim 16 by going up to the Parking level. Your bus waits in the airport's charter staging system instead of circling the arrivals drive, so the entire team can load together from one named pickup point; the step-by-step route is on the official SEA charter bus pickup instructions.

PCS season — May through August — is the highest-demand period for military airport transfers across the Puget Sound region, and vehicle availability tightens significantly during those months. Booking two to four weeks in advance during PCS season is strongly recommended. Outside of PCS season, lead times are more flexible, but booking early still gives you the widest selection of vehicle types and the most competitive pricing from the network.
